Manchester United went fourth in the Premier League after a dramatic late winner from Marcus Rashford gave them a 1-0 victory over West Ham United at Old Trafford on Saturday. There was no suggestion of the drama that was to come, as it was a game of half-chances and only one save was forced of the two goalkeepers, with Alphonse Areola saving from Fred's left-footed drive on 49 minutes.
